Saudi Ceramics Company has announced that it has signed a SAR3.07 million ($819,500) purchase order with Sadr Logistics Services Company to supply wooden pallets for a project to install storage systems at its central warehouse in Riyadh.
The purchase order is part of a broader project with Sadr Logistics valued at SAR13 million, thus bringing the total value of contracts with the company to SAR16.07 million, excluding value-added tax, Saudi Ceramics said in its bourse filing.
Saudi Ceramics said the project aims to improve operational efficiency and increase storage capacity at its Riyadh warehouse.
The pallet supply order is expected to be fulfilled within four months, with the financial impact expected to be recognised in the third and fourth quarters of 2026, it added.
